免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

使用vue做的app

Vue.js 是一款流行的 JavaScript 框架,可用于开发 Web 应用程序。它旨在通过简化代码、提高性能和提高用户体验来提高开发效率。Vue.js 具有以下优点:

1. 可重用的组件。Vue.js 允许您通过将应用程序拆分为可重用的组件来提高代码重用性。这可以显著缩短开发时间并降低维护成本。

2. 反应式数据绑定。Vue.js 的数据绑定机制可以确保视图始终保持最新状态。只要数据发生变化,就会立即更新相关的DOM元素,这使得开发人员不需要手动管理DOM元素。

3. 高效的虚拟DOM。Vue.js 可以高效地处理大量的DOM操作。这使得应用程序的性能得到了显著提高。

4. 简化的模板语法。Vue.js的模板语法非常简单易懂,使得编写模板变得更加轻松和快捷。

下面,我将详细介绍一下我使用Vue.js开发的一个App的原理。

我使用Vue.js来开发一款移动App应用程序,旨在提供用户一种方便购物的方式。在用户使用我们的应用程序时,他们可以访问各种产品数据,包括图片、价格、产品描述等。用户可以将所喜欢的产品添加到购物车中, 然后直接下单购买。

产品数据存储在后端服务器中,我们使用Vue.js来获取这些数据并将其呈现给用户。 Vue.js 具有一个称为vue-resource的插件,可以帮助我们管理与后端服务器的所有网络请求。这个插件可以让我们轻松地发送HTTP请求和接收服务器响应。

在我们的应用程序中,我们使用Vue.js的组件来呈现页面,每个组件都渲染一个特定的区域。例如,我们有一个产品列表组件,该组件负责呈现所有产品的列表。我们还有一个购物车组件,该组件包含用户当前已经添加到购物车中的所有产品。

Vue.js的组件可以嵌套,这意味着我们可以将嵌套的组件拼合在一起以构建完整的应用程序。在我们的购物App中,我们通过将多个组件嵌套在一起来构建应用程序的页面。

Vue.js的数据绑定机制是非常有用的,在我们的应用程序中使用反应式数据绑定机制。如果一个用户更新购物车,这个数据更新将立即反映在购物车组件中,而无需刷新整个页面。

Vue.js的虚拟DOM机制可以帮助我们优化应用的性能,因为它可以处理不必要的DOM操作。在我们的应用程序中,每当用户添加或删除产品时,虚拟DOM都将重新计算最小可能的DOM更新。

在我们购物App中,Vue.js的模板语法被广泛使用,我们使用Vue.js的模板语法来快速生成用户界面。例如,我们可以使用Vue.js的v-for指令来实现循环产品列表,v-bind指令来绑定数据。

总的来说,Vue.js是我们构建购物App的理想选择。它降低了开发成本,提高了代码的重用性,并提高了应用程序的性能。Vue.js的反应式数据绑定和虚拟DOM机制可以确保应用程序总是保持最新状态,而模板语法使得编写模板变得更加轻松和快捷。


相关知识:
做网站做app
做网站和做App都是现代互联网领域的热门话题,两者都是通过互联网来实现信息交流、商务活动等。做网站:做网站的本质就是建立一个能够被互联网上的用户访问的页面。通常情况下,做一个网站需要以下步骤:1. 确定网站主题:根据自己的兴趣和需求,确定网站的主体内容,例
2023-05-18
做一个商城app网站多少钱
一个商城app网站的成本因很多因素而异,包括复杂性、设计、功能和开发时间等。以下是一些可能会影响商城app网站成本的因素:1.商城app的类型:商城app可以是基于iOS、Android、还是在两个平台上同时运行的混合移动应用,不同类型的商城app开发成本
2023-05-18
做一个网站app需要多少钱
做一个网站 App 的费用主要取决于多个因素。这些因素包括开发人员的水平、应用范围、功能要求、技术选型等。在本文中,我们将介绍网站 App 的主要开发成本来源。网站 App 的主要成本1.开发人员的费用网站 App 的开发需要技术人员。这些人员的费用根据其
2023-05-18
网站平台app做垫付单被骗
垫付单是一种经济活动,是指需要先垫付货款的采购活动,往往出现在小额交易领域,特别是在电子商务领域。而在网站平台中,许多卖家在进行交易时都会利用垫付单来保证自己的利益。但是,在这个过程中也难免会出现一些问题。近年来,有些人利用网站平台app的垫付单系统进行诈
2023-05-18
网页做出个app
随着移动互联网的逐步普及,越来越多的企业开始考虑如何将自己的网页转变成APP,以提供更好的用户体验和更强的竞争力。那么,如何将网页转化成APP呢?本文将针对这个问题进行原理介绍和详细的步骤说明。一、原理介绍将网页转化成APP的核心原理是通过一些工具和技术实
2023-05-18
淘宝的app是基于html做的
淘宝是中国最大的电商平台之一,它既有电脑网页版,也有移动端的app。而淘宝的app是基于html做的,这是因为html具有良好的跨平台性和可扩展性。首先,淘宝app的页面是由html代码构建而成的。也就是说,所有的界面元素,比如文本、图片、按钮等等,都是在
2023-05-18
手机app可以做网页版吗
简单来说,手机App可以通过嵌入一个Webview来显示网页内容,以达到在手机上展示网页的效果,也就是可以做网页版。下面我将从技术角度对这个问题进行详细介绍。一、什么是Webview?Webview是一种特殊的View,可以嵌入到应用程序中,用于展示Web
2023-05-18
如何把自己的网站做成app
将网站转换成app是许多网站管理员和开发人员在不断探索和研究的话题。网站在不断发展壮大的同时,很多人希望能够利用移动端的市场优势,将网站转换成app,以拓展更广阔的用户群体。在这篇文章中,我将详细介绍将网站转换成app的原理和方法,希望能够为读者带来启发。
2023-05-18
没基础做app对接网站
许多公司和创业者想要开发一个移动应用程序,以吸引更多用户和客户。然而,在设计和开发程序之前,他们需要学习怎样将一个应用程序对接到一个网站上。接下来我会向您介绍一些基本的概念并提供一些指南,以帮助那些从未开发过应用程序的人可以顺利对接网站。首先,让我们看看这
2023-05-18
vue可以做app么
Vue是一款流行的JavaScript框架,主要用于构建交互式的web应用程序。随着移动应用程序的普及,Vue在移动应用程序开发中也变得越来越流行。虽然Vue本身不是专门为移动应用程序设计的,但是使用Vue开发原生应用程序是有可能的。在本文中,我们将介绍使
2023-05-18
html5做一个app
HTML5是一种基于Web的技术,允许你使用HTML,CSS和JavaScript来构建应用程序。这些应用程序可以在不同的设备上运行,并具有很强的可移植性。本文将介绍如何使用HTML5构建应用程序。HTML5与APP的关系HTML5应用程序不需要安装或下载
2023-05-18
bootstrap做app
Bootstrap是一个能够让网页、应用程序和移动设备使用的前端框架。Bootstrap通过提供HTML、CSS和JavaScript模板来简化Web开发,它包含了大量的组件和样式,可大大减少前端开发的时间和工作量。在这篇文章中,我们将会详细介绍如何用 B
2023-05-18
©2015-2021 智电瑞创 蜀ICP备17039183号